Why Now

Public sector blockchain meant
building from scratch each time

To adopt SaaS, a public agency must pass rigorous security certification such as CSAP. With virtually no CSAP-certified SaaS in the blockchain space, each agency has had to build its own, taking at least a year and hundreds of millions of won upfront.
Meanwhile, government investment keeps growing: the 2024 support program expanded to KRW 20B across 14 projects, and the public sector remains where demand for blockchain is greatest.

Platform

Built-in functionality

Through selective disclosure, users submit only what's required; personal data stays on devices and in distributed storage, easing the agency burden. A standardized identity flow covers issuance, custody, and verification.

  • DID·VC·VP · Identity credentials

    Issues and verifies digital identity and qualification credentials whose authenticity can be checked.

  • Wallet

    Users hold their credentials and submit only what each situation requires.

  • PDS · Personal Data Store

    Keeps data under user control and reduces the institution’s storage burden.

  • BFS · Distributed storage

    Splits large data across multiple locations so it stays retrievable and tamper-free.
